On Friday a group of Year 3 and 4 boys took part in the first ever South Tyneside football festival for children of their age. The boys were placed in a group with 6 other schools and only the top 2 would go on to the next round. In the First game against East Boldon the boys won 2-0 with Jack R and Jack D scoring the goals. In game 2 the boys beat St Aloysius B 5-0 with goal for jack D, Jack R and 3 for Logan. In game 3 the boys beat Mortimer B 3-0 with goals for Mason, Jack R and Logan. In the fourth game the boys beat Lord Blyton 2-0 with goals for Theo and Jack D. In game 5 we beat St Bede 1-0 with a goal for Theo and in the final game they beat St Joseph 4-0 with Max, Theo, Jack D and Mason getting the goals. This meant the boys had topped the group and were into the semi finals.

In the semi final against St Aloysius A the boys played very well but were unable to score a goal in normal time or extra time so we went to a penalty shoot out. Max, Mason and Logan all converted their penalties and St Aloysius missed one of theirs meaning the lads were in the final.

In the final they played Lord Blyton who they had already defeated in the group stage. Once again they were unable to score, despite hitting the bar and having a header cleared off the line, so it was down to penalties. This time the all the penaties in the shoot out were missed with Daniel twice saving Lord Blyton penalties. Jack D then stepped up to take a penalty in sudden death and he scored the winner.

The boys can all be very proud of themselves for the football they played and their sportsmanship.
